Transaction 3830620341a8890fe695c7c18751fd7f5c38d1e170ab407d6a81fd300c38cd64
1 Input
1 Output
-
3830620341a8890fe695c7c18751fd7f5c38d1e170ab407d6a81fd300c38cd64:0
- value
- 89025
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 879d72868c79263f20d384be0e074a44cbf62a2e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DN4qXr9GyYTnYmqgfdaCFFWM96PwwCdbx